Packed Lunches

If preferred, children can bring a packed lunch to school. This is eaten in the dining hall at the same time as the meals are served. Packed lunches should be brought in a named lunch box. If children bring a packed lunch, drinking water is freely available on the table.

Milk

The school is part of the ‘Cool Milk for Schools’ scheme, where milk is provided, if required, to children in all classes. Children under 5 years are entitled to a carton of milk free, which is delivered fresh to school each day and stored in the refrigerator until morning break time. Once a child is 5 years old the milk can be bought at a cost approx £18 a term. This is ordered direct from Cool Milk for School. The school handles none of the money or the ordering arrangements for the milk.

Snacks

Sweets and chewing gum are not allowed in school. If children require a snack at break times, then healthy options such as easily peeled fruit are encouraged. Our school takes part in the Free Fruit Scheme. Each infant child is offered a piece of fresh fruit every day.
